COLUMN

ENGINEER

2026.04.21

社内システム開発でよく出る専門用語を初めてでも分かるように解説

社内システムの現場では「要件定義」「運用保守」「SLA」「アジャイル」などの専門用語が頻出し、初学者にとって障壁になりがちです。本記事は、システム開発・システム運用・受託開発や独自システムの文脈で登場する用語を、比喩と実務例で噛み砕いて説明します。会話の齟齬を減らし、意思決定を素早くするための基礎固めに最適な入門ガイドです。

【目次】

1.システム開発で頻出する基本専門用語を丁寧に理解する

2.社内システム運用で押さえるべき重要キーワード解説

3.受託開発と独自システム構築で登場する用語を体系的に学ぶ

4.まとめ

システム開発で頻出する基本専門用語を丁寧に理解する

まず押さえるべき結論は、要件定義・設計・実装・テストという工程を正しく理解し、アジャイルとウォーターフォールの違いを状況で使い分けることです。その理由は、工程と進め方の理解が、品質・コスト・納期のバランスを左右し、日々の意思決定の土台になるからです。家づくりに例えると、要件定義は「どんな家にするかの希望整理」、設計は「設計図づくり」、実装は「建築工事」、テストは「内覧会で不具合を洗い出す」に相当します。アジャイルは小さな部屋から作って住みながら改修していく方法、ウォーターフォールは設計図を先に固めて一気に建てる方法です。たとえば社内の申請システムでは、要件定義で“誰が何をいつ申請するか”を具体化し、設計で画面遷移とデータ項目を定めます。アジャイルなら休暇申請を先に出し、利用者の声を反映して出張申請へ拡張します。ウォーターフォールなら全機能の要件を合意し、まとめて作ります。要件の変動幅が大きい、ユーザー検証を早く回したいならアジャイル、規制対応や厳格な品質保証が必要で変更コストを抑えたいならウォーターフォールが有利です。専門用語は工程の地図です。比喩で意味を結び付ければ会話が通じやすく、プロジェクトの前進速度が上がります。

社内システム運用で押さえるべき重要キーワード解説

結論として、可用性、SLA、監視、障害対応、ログ、バックアップの理解が、システム運用の信頼性を決めます。理由は、止まらない仕組みと、止まったときに素早く戻す仕組みの両輪がそろって初めて、業務影響を最小化できるからです。可用性は「どれだけ止まらないか」を示す指標、SLAは「どこまで責任を持つかの約束事」です。監視は体温計、ログは診療記録、バックアップは金庫の写しに例えられます。例えば社内ポータルに99.9%の可用性を設定し、SLAで「平日9-18時は1時間以内に一次対応」と合意します。監視ツールでCPU・メモリ・応答時間に閾値を設け、超過したら通知。障害発生時はログで時系列を辿り、RPO(どこまでのデータを守るか)とRTO(どれくらいで復旧するか)に沿って復旧手順を実行します。復旧後は原因分析と再発防止案をレビューに残し、監視項目や手順を更新します。これらの用語を点ではなく線で結ぶと、安定稼働と説明責任が両立し、利用部門からの信頼が着実に高まります。

受託開発と独自システム構築で登場する用語を体系的に学ぶ

結論は、受託開発と独自システム(内製)では、契約・変更管理・拡張性に関わる用語の前提が異なり、その違いを理解すると最適な意思決定ができるということです。理由は、前者は契約で責任と成果物を明確化し、後者は継続的な適応力と知識蓄積が価値になるからです。受託開発では、RFP、見積、スコープ、請負や準委任といった契約形態、変更要求(CR)、受け入れテスト(UAT)が鍵です。独自システムでは、技術選定、アーキテクチャ、内製ロードマップ、ドメイン知識の蓄積が中心概念になります。例えば受託で営業管理システムを作る場合、RFPで要件を提示し、見積・契約でスコープと納期を確定、途中の要望変更はCRとしてコストと期限を協議します。独自システムなら、将来の分析需要を見据えてAPI設計や疎結合なマイクロサービスを採用し、段階的に機能を差し替えられるようにします。受託の強みは期限と予算の確実性、内製の強みは学習と改善の継続性です。背景にある目的を理解し、変更管理と拡張性の視点を常に携えることが、どちらの道を選んでも成功を近づけます。

まとめ

本記事は、システム開発の工程、システム運用の基礎指標、受託開発と独自システムの要点を、比喩と実例で横断的に整理しました。要件定義やSLAなどの用語は、合意形成や品質保証の“設計図”です。家づくりや診療記録に置き換えて覚えれば、会話の齟齬が減り、意思決定が早まります。次の一歩として、自社の運用設計や契約実務に落とし込み、継続的に見直しましょう。

ARCHIVE